本站所有资源均为高质量资源,各种姿势下载。
三对角矩阵算法(TDMA)是求解具有三对角结构的线性方程组的一种高效方法,特别适用于雷诺方程等流体力学问题的数值求解。这种算法基于高斯消元法的简化版本,通过利用矩阵的稀疏特性显著减少计算量。
对于雷诺方程的求解,TDMA算法的优势主要体现在三个方面:首先,它只需要存储矩阵的非零元素,大幅降低内存需求;其次,计算复杂度仅为O(n),远优于传统高斯消元的O(n³);最后,算法实现简单,适合大规模工程计算。
典型的TDMA求解过程分为两个阶段:前向消元和反向代换。前向消元阶段逐步消除下对角线元素,将矩阵转化为上三角形式;反向代换阶段则从最后一个方程开始回代求解。整个过程只需遍历矩阵两次,且每次只需处理三个相邻元素。
在实际应用中,TDMA算法特别适合求解一维问题或可分离的多维问题。对于雷诺方程这种描述润滑膜压力分布的微分方程,离散化后往往形成三对角系统,TDMA就成为理想的选择。